AI summary

Kriti Industries reported Q4 FY26 revenue of INR 142 crores (3% YoY growth) with dramatic EBITDA improvement to INR 18 crores from just INR 20 lakhs in Q4 last year, translating to EBITDA margins of 12.91% versus 0.15% previously. Full year FY26 revenue declined 19% to INR 587 crores due to challenging first nine months, but EBITDA grew 23% to INR 35 crores with margins expanding 201 basis points to 5.94%. Management highlighted that building products offer better margins (14-18%) compared to agriculture (8-10%) and plans to focus on this segment going forward. CAPEX remains on hold pending review of first two quarters. The company is expanding CPVC capacity specifically as it offers better margins, while deferring decisions on a second manufacturing plant.

Likely market impact

The company has demonstrated significant operational improvement in Q4 with margin expansion, though full-year revenue decline remains a concern. Management's focus on higher-margin building products and CPVC expansion could support profitability, but investors should note the low base effect driving expected FY27 growth and the on-hold CAPEX stance.
